      <description>The Yamaha NS-10M studio reference monitor speaker (aka NS10M) is widely popular amongst audio professionals, and is notorious for its very flat frequency response even to the point that they are not pleasant to listen to. The wants and needs of the audio engineer are different than the typical consumer, so this is a welcome thing as the NS-10M monitors will reveal the truth of mix.&amp;nbsp; The NS-10M studio monitors are almost an industry standard for mixing and are easily recognized by their standout white mid-range driver.       <description>The Infinity Primus P162 are entry-level 2-way bookshelf speakers at the top of the Primus line from Infinity systems. They feature a 3/4&amp;quot; tweeter and 6 1/2&amp;quot; mid-range woofer. Both the mid-range and high frequency drivers are made from Metal Matrix Diaphragm material (MMD) found in Infinity's flagship Cascade series. MMD features a stiff aluminum core, anodized on both sides for increased strength and rigidity. Compared to paper, polypropylene, and kevlar drivers MMD conduct faster, removing unwanted resonance frequencies.       <description>Definitive Technology BP6B are the entry-level model Definitive Technology's Bipolar Tower line of floor-standing speakers that retail for about $400 per speaker. Unlike most of its competitors, the BP6B is a bipolar speaker, meaning that they have speaker drivers facing both to the front and the rear in the same phase creating a more broad soundstage as sound is reflected off of walls and is difficult to pinpoint where it's coming from. Unlike dipolar speakers, which feature drivers that are in reverse phase, that create a cancellation pattern, bipolar speakers actually create a bass boost from the constructive interference patterns.
